Ghana - Import of Footwear with Outer Soles and Uppers of Leather
Since 2013, Ghana Import of Footwear with Outer Soles and Uppers of Leather was up 38.8% year on year. At $292,495.06 in 2018, the country was number 112 among other countries in Import of Footwear with Outer Soles and Uppers of Leather. Ghana is overtaken by Trinidad and Tobago, which was ranked number 111 at $311,343 and is followed by Brunei with $284,575.4. United States lead the ranking with $796,522,477.7 in 2019, that is a fall of 0.5% compared to 2018. France, United Kingdom and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Burundi recorded the best 5 years average growth at +126.4% per year, while Gambia recorded the worst performance at -58.4% per year.
